1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a scale drawing?
Back
A scale drawing is a representation of an object that is proportional to its actual size, using a specific ratio or scale.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does a scale factor represent?
Back
A scale factor is the ratio of the dimensions of the drawing to the dimensions of the actual object.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
If a scale factor is 1:4, what does this mean?
Back
This means that 1 unit on the drawing represents 4 units in reality.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do you calculate the actual size from a scale drawing?
Back
Multiply the measurement on the drawing by the scale factor.
